Karp, Warren Bill was born on February 12, 1944 in Brooklyn.
Medical and dental educator researcher
Karp, Warren Bill was born on February 12, 1944 in Brooklyn.
Bachelor of Science in Chemistry, Pace University, 1965. Doctor of Philosophy, Ohio State University, 1970. Doctor of Medical Dentistry, Medical College Georgia, 1977.
Graduate teaching assistant physiological chemistry, 1966-1968;
graduate research associate physiological chemistry, Ohio State University, 1968-1970;
postdoctoral research associate pediatrics, Ohio State University, 1970-1971;
with, Medical College Georgia, Augusta, since 1971;
professor School Graduate Studies, Medical College Georgia, since 1988;
professor oral diagnosis and patient care services, Medical College Georgia, since 1988;
professor oral biology, Medical College Georgia, since 1988;
professor pediatrics, Medical College Georgia, since 1988;
professor biochemistry and molecular biology, Medical College Georgia, since 1991. Director clinical perinatal laboratory Medical College Georgia Hospitals and Clinics, since 1977. Director nutritional consultant services Medical College Georgia Dental School, since 1987.
Research chairman Georgia Nutrition Council, 1989-1990. Lecturer and speaker in field.
Member American Association for the Advancement of Science, American Chemical Society, American Association Dental Research, American Heart Association (grantee 1981-1982, nutrition committee 1988-1991, health site committee 1990-1991), New York Academy of Sciences, Georgia Institute Human Nutrition, Georgia Perinatal Association, Georgia Nutrition Council (research chairman 1989-1990, nominating committee 1990-1991), International Association Dental Research, Southern Society Pediatric Research, Sigma Xi (membership chairman 1971-1975, 78-80, awards committee 1979-1980, treasurer 1980-1984, audtior 1985-1986, president 1987-1988).
Married Nancy Virginia Blanchard, January 4, 1976. Children: Heather Anna, Michael Aaron.
